Red Rock Resources plc said it has signed a
deal with Zambian firm Chiman Manufacturing Ltd for the processing of manganese
to produce ferromanganese.
The mineral exploration and development company said Chiman will provide
crushing, preparation, and processing of ore supplied by Red Rock's Zambian unit
from stockpiles and surface material at its Chiwefwe mining license.
The company added it expects to make first deliveries shortly.

Issue of Equity
Dated: 1 October 2010

Red Rock Resources plc ("Red Rock" or the "Company") announces that it has today issued 998,460 new ordinary shares of 0.1 pence each ('Ordinary Shares') in the Company at a price of 6 pence per Ordinary Share, in settlement of an agreed invoice from Kansai Mining Corporation, conditional on the Shares being admitted to trading on AIM (the "Issue").

Following the issue of the Shares the Company's total issued ordinary share capital will be 654,387,240 ordinary shares of 0.1p. Application will be made to the London Stock Exchange for the Shares, which rank pari passu with the Company's existing issued ordinary shares, to be admitted to trading on AIM. Dealings are expected to commence at 8.00 a.m. on 7 October 2010.
